Victoria's Secret Pink London Store Finder

Find all of the Victoria's Secret Pink stores in London
Victoria's Secret Pink image
Victoria's Secret Pink (Shepherd's Bush)
2046, Westfield London, Ariel Way, Shepherd's Bush, London, W12 7GB
Nearest Station
Wood Lane 0.20 miles
Victoria's Secret Pink image
163, Westfield Stratford City, Montfichet Road, Stratford, London, E20 1EL
Nearest Station
Stratford International 0.30 miles
Page 1 of 1